Forex trading is a complex and often unpredictable market, so it is important to have a good grasp of both fundamental and technical analysis when trying to understand how it works. Fundamental analysis involves studying the underlying economic, political, and social factors that affect the value of a currency. Technical analysis, on the other hand, involves the study of chart patterns, trends, and price movements to identify potential trading opportunities.

Fundamental analysis can be used to assess the overall health of a currency, by looking at the economic, political, and social factors that influence it. It can also give traders an insight into the future direction of a currency and allow them to develop strategies to take advantage of the opportunities that arise. Fundamental analysis helps traders understand the underlying drivers of the currency and make better-informed decisions.

Technical analysis, meanwhile, focuses on the study of past price movements and chart patterns, and can be used to identify potential trading opportunities. Technical analysis can be used to identify trends and support and resistance levels, which can help traders determine where to enter and exit a position. It is also useful for predicting short-term price movements, such as identifying potential areas of support or resistance.

When trading forex, it is important to understand both fundamental and technical analysis, as both can provide valuable insights into the currency markets. While fundamental analysis can be used to assess the long-term prospects of a currency, technical analysis can be used to identify short-term opportunities. By combining both types of analysis, traders can gain a better understanding of the currency markets and develop more effective trading strategies.
